Output 86a3b0a01b5f98c16618f8a17826011e4e8dfdcc2ca215f57fd13fc6ab72ff58:1

value
40957029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3762fddbac131ff87e2f91fb09f6f41eec564 OP_EQUAL
address
3BMEXhWKy7LnDFv2yreNWDfTQK6hGgudV2
transaction
86a3b0a01b5f98c16618f8a17826011e4e8dfdcc2ca215f57fd13fc6ab72ff58
confirmations
411317
spent
true